Percy Copeland

Epithet: First World War soldier

Record type: First World War Biographies

Town / Village residence: Douglas

Biography: First World War Soldier. 'No. 58636. Private. A.S.C. (Army Service Corps). Joined up Mar. 4 1918. Communicant etc. Nov. 1918 Hut 1. 48 Squad. A.S.C. Remount Depot. Ormskirk Later 258636. Driver. A-/346 Bde (Brigade) R.F.A. (Royal Field Artillery) Marton Hall Marton. Middlesborough Yorkshire' (Extract from handwritten notes by The Reverend Robert Daniel Kermode, Vicar of St George's Church, Douglas, about men from his parish serving in the First World War. MS 10003/4)
